i don't know about the section, but graphics cards range in price because of the manufacturer. Although, for example, they may be nvidia, they may vary depending on who makes them, evga or bfg, because of quality, waranty, and other factors
PC parts differ in price depends on the chip customization, driver features, support quality, and other factors. Products from Asus typically allows easier over clocking (but most warranty do not cover damage from over clocking though).
